The Whispering Voices

In the head they whisper;
‘What a complete loser’
As sharp as a barbed wire
Cuts through a wretched spirit
A ghost to fight tooth for tooth
Once you let the voices in
You let the deceiver win
‘The sky is yellow’
The voices whisper

In the air they whisper
‘Do as you like my child’
As sweet as mouth-watering honey
Skin tickles to the sound of money
Biggest smile ever to reach the ears
Talking breeze fools the world
Once you listen to the sweet voice
You listen to the sweet liar
‘Golden life is on offer’
The voices whisper

To the heart they whisper
‘It’s time for change of hearts’
As sweet as a vanilla tongue
Perseverance not on the map
Anybody can fall into the trap
Persons are showered with choices
Once you hear the voices
Hear only the true voice
‘You know right from wrong’
The voice whispers.
